Research Abstract

Programmed change of the structural color of colloidal crystals is practical importance for photonic devices. Also, photophysical and photochemical processes inside the colloidal crystal is interesting with relation to optical confinement. A promising solution for the tenability is to apply external magnetic field to highly deionized colloidal suspension of the mono-dispersed composite particles that contain magnetic core inside the dielectric shell. We have investigated the magnetic tenability of the structural color of the maghemite/silica composite particle colloid. We followed the reported synthetic procedure to obtain the nearly mono-dispersed colloidal suspension show the magnetic tenability as is expected. The reflectance peak shifted towards the longer wavelength by 2Onm, upon the application of magnetic field (〜0.2T). Other results including the thermal fluctuation of the particle packed in the colloidal crystal and the enlargement of the lifetime of the fluorescence was examined.
